Aerzen USA Corp. is an international manufacturer of positive displacement blowers, hybrid blowers, screw compressors and turbo blowers. These high-quality machines are used for air and gas applications across many essential industries, including wastewater, cement, biogas, pharmaceutical and food, among others. POSITION SUMMARY Leads customer relationship management and develops new customers for Aerzen blower and compressor solutions into pneumatic conveying, high vacuum, and other air & gas compression and conveyance applications in industrial markets of the applicable region. Calls on end-user customers, engineering firms and OEMs who specify/purchase our equipment and influence their purchasing specifications to include Aerzen products. Develops new customers within the market/region and identifies new applications for Aerzen products. Manage and support relationships with existing customers and grow aftermarket business in the assigned territory. Manage relationships with key customer accounts, understanding the landscape, decision-makers, and how decisions are made. Provide support to customers, OEMs, and engineering firms as needed: equipment selection, review of specifications, compliance with standards, total cost of ownership analyses, etc. Prepare quotations and bid submittals; coordinate support for pre-bid meetings and follow-up. Prepare and deliver professional presentations and coordinate customer education as required. Prepare sales projections, forecasts, strategies, and reports using the CRM system as applicable. Assist in marketing plan development and implementation; support regional and national trade shows and attend/show as needed. Support order processing and customer follow-up throughout the order execution process. Collaborate with the Project Sales Manager, Process Gas on key projects for blower and compressor solutions for process gas and air. Collaborate with the Reliability Engineer to identify upgrade and retrofit opportunities for Aerzen solutions in existing operations. Interact professionally with Aerzen project management, engineering, production, and customer support to provide knowledge about customers and orders. Position qualifications
